Galway United 2-2 UCD

Galway can feel satisfied with a share of the spoils against the enterprising Students

The spoils were shared at Terryland Park as Galway United and UCD produced a surprisingly open encounter.

UCD took an early lead courtesy of an opportunistic fourth minute
David McMillan goal, but Galway came back into the contest.

Anto Flood equalised in the 19th minute when nudging home a Rhys Meynell cross, and a Stephen O’Donnell penalty edged Galway in front on 36 minutes.

But UCD equalised in the 44th minute when Chris Mulhall dispossessed Barry Ryan as the Students grabbed a draw.

After an encouraging draw at Oriel Park against Dundalk, Galway United were anxious to deliver a positive performance on their home turf.

But it was the Students who made most of the early running as Martin Russell’s nifty outfit enjoyed a productive start.

Barry Ryan denied David McMillan in the second minute as UCD settled quickly with Chris Mulhall impressing in a free role.

Ciaran Kilduff forced another save from Ryan, but McMillan rattled the Galway net, steering the loose ball home from close range.

Galway’s response was impressive as Ciaran Foley smashed a shot wide from distance before parity was restored in the 19th minute.

Rhys Meynell’s left wing delivery caused panic in the area and Anto Flood appeared to get the final touch to put Galway back on terms.

The drama continued to unfold before the break as referee Graham Kelly awarded a penalty in the 36th minute when Evan McMillan handled in the area following a sharp Flood turn, and Stephen O’Donnell’s spot-kick was accurate.

But UCD responded on the stroke of half-time as Chris Mulhall
dispossessed Galway goalkeeper Ryan and the Students were level again.

A splendid 58th minute cross from Kilduff manufactured a chance for David McMillan, but Ryan was alert to save with his feet.

Then just past the hour mark Greg Bolger and Kilduff were involved, but Michael Leahy’s shot was deflected over for a corner.

Galway United: Barry Ryan; Conneely (Heary, 75), McKenzie, Synott, Meynell; Bobby Ryan, Foley (Curran, 90), O'Donnell, McBrien (Creaney, 31); Sheppard, Flood.

UCD: Brennan; Harding, Leahy, E McMillan, Shortall; Corry (Ward, 73), Bolger, Creevy (Nangle, 83); Mulhall, D McMillan, Kilduff (Wilson, 73).

Referee: G Kelly (Cork).
